> *following scripts had been added
> /etc/init.d/target
> /etc/target/tcm_start.sh
> /etc/target/lio_start.sh
>
> Signed-off-by: Chunrong Guo <b40290 at freescale.com>
> ---
> recipes-tools/lio-utils/lio-utils_4.0.bb | 9 ++++++---
> 1 file changed, 6 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)
>
> diff --git a/recipes-tools/lio-utils/lio-utils_4.0.bb b/recipes-tools/lio-utils/lio-utils_4.0.bb
> index 31aa4fa..98101b3 100644
> --- a/recipes-tools/lio-utils/lio-utils_4.0.bb
> +++ b/recipes-tools/lio-utils/lio-utils_4.0.bb
> @@ -4,7 +4,7 @@ HOMEPAGE = "http://linux-iscsi.org/index.php/Lio-utils"
> LICENSE = "GPLv2"
> LIC_FILES_CHKSUM = "file://debian/copyright;md5=c3ea231a32635cbb5debedf3e88aa3df"
>
> -PR = "r1"
> +PR = "r2"
>
> SRC_URI = "git://risingtidesystems.com/lio-utils.git;protocal=git \
> file://lio-utils-install-more-modules.patch "
> @@ -46,13 +46,16 @@ do_install() {
> if test -d ${S}/tools; then
> oe_runmake install
> fi
> -
> +
> + install -d ${D}/etc/target/
> install -d ${D}/etc/init.d/
> install -m 755 ${S}/scripts/rc.target ${D}/etc/init.d/
> + install -m 755 ${S}/conf/tcm_start.default ${D}/etc/target/tcm_start.sh
> + install -m 755 ${S}/conf/lio_start.default ${D}/etc/target/lio_start.sh
> }
>
> RDEPENDS_${PN} += "python-stringold python-subprocess python-shell \
> python-datetime python-textutils python-crypt python-netclient python-email"
>
>
> -FILES_${PN} += "${sbindir}/* /etc/init.d/*"
> +FILES_${PN} += "${sbindir}/* /etc/init.d/* /etc/target/*"
